如何在C++、Java、C#.net和***中声明基本数据类型并初始化?请提供每种语言的示例代码。
时间: 2024-11-19 07:30:28 浏览: 1
理解不同编程语言中基本数据类型的声明和初始化对于掌握这些语言至关重要。这里,我们将通过对比这四种语言的语法来展示如何声明基本数据类型,并提供每个语言的示例代码。这个过程会帮助你快速理解它们之间的差异和相似之处。
参考资源链接:[C++、Java、C#.net、VB.net 语言语法对比分析](https://wenku.csdn.net/doc/6401acd3cce7214c316ed488?spm=1055.2569.3001.10343)
以下是每种语言声明和初始化基本数据类型的代码示例:
- **C++**:
```cpp
int number = 10;
double floatingPoint = 3.14;
char character = 'A';
bool isTrue = true;
```
- **Java**:
```java
int number = 10;
double floatingPoint = 3.14;
char character = 'A';
boolean isTrue = true;
```
- **C#.net**:
```csharp
int number = 10;
double floatingPoint = 3.14;
char character = 'A';
bool isTrue = true;
```
- ***:
```***
Dim number As Integer = 10
Dim floatingPoint As Double = 3.14
Dim character As Char = 'A'
Dim isTrue As Boolean = True
```
在上述示例中,我们声明了整型(`int`或`Integer`)、双精度浮点型(`double`或`Double`)、字符型(`char`或`Char`)和布尔型(`bool`或`Boolean`)。需要注意的是,C++中字符型使用单引号,而其他三种语言使用单引号表示字符。
学习和对比这些基本数据类型的声明方式,对于掌握编程语言的基本概念十分有帮助。为了深入学习这些语言的语法结构,我推荐阅读《C++、Java、C#.net、*** 语言语法对比分析》。这篇文章提供了这四种编程语言的详细语法对比,不仅包含基本数据类型的声明,还包括变量、常量、数组以及更高级的特性。通过这篇文章,你可以快速地在熟悉一种语言的基础上理解其他语言,提升你的编程技能和效率。
参考资源链接:[C++、Java、C#.net、VB.net 语言语法对比分析](https://wenku.csdn.net/doc/6401acd3cce7214c316ed488?spm=1055.2569.3001.10343)
阅读全文